Overview
Locus Vector is an autonomous mobile robot (AMR) designed for warehouse putaway operations. It integrates with the LocusONE platform to handle reverse picking, returns management, and restocking tasks. The robot reduces aisle congestion, improves worker productivity through task interleaving, and eliminates the need for separate picking and putaway teams in warehouse operations.
